11th Annual New Jersey Work Zone Safety Awareness Conference
| This event took place |
April 8, 2010 | |
| Location | Rutgers University Livingston Campus Student Center Piscataway, NJ 08854 |

Work Zone Awareness Week 2010 is being observed in New Jersey with this annual event. This year's national theme is "Work Zones Need Your Undivided Attention." The conference promotes work zone safety awareness among a multidisciplinary audience from construction, maintenance and operations, engineering, and public safety. This year, the agenda will include presentations regarding changes to the MUTCD Part 6, the OSHA perspective on how the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act's (ARRA) has increased roadway construction, a panel discussion of work zone safety protective equipment, and a case study session with interactive roundtable discussion. |

| Sponsors/Partners | The New Jersey Work Zone Safety Partnership (NJWZSP) is an ad hoc committee with the primary goal of promoting work zone safety education and awareness to reduce the number of workers being killed in work zones. The NJWZSP includes representatives from AGC, APA, CIAP, FHWA–NJ Division, UTCA, NJ Laborers’ Health & Safety Fund, General Laborers Locals # 172 and # 472, New Jersey Division of Highway Traffic Safety, NJDOT, New Jersey State Police, OHSA, Rutgers' CAIT-NJ LTAP, the utility industry, and several other agencies.
